Union Bank of India - RIHAND NAGAR

The IFSC code for Union Bank of India RIHAND NAGAR branch is UBIN0550116. This branch is located in RIHAND NAGAR, UTTAR PRADESH and provides comprehensive banking services including electronic fund transfers through NEFT, RTGS, IMPS, and UPI.

IFSC code UBIN0550116 is required for all online money transfers to accounts held at Union Bank of India RIHAND NAGAR branch. Whether you're receiving salary, making bill payments, or transferring money to family and friends, ensure you use this correct IFSC code for seamless transactions.
